Output 6a35384eb28045bfa78bfaff2f68709bb1e3c05af065192571aa2f96c9cc1ad3:17

value
20199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deafec90c8f8f6a8fdca495791cc8edd0cdfcb18 OP_EQUAL
address
3MzUgYqgcu1H3BWpkJYBiAAtd7jjVSrN1i
transaction
6a35384eb28045bfa78bfaff2f68709bb1e3c05af065192571aa2f96c9cc1ad3
confirmations
216721
spent
true